Passing the CPUARMState around in the decoder is a recipe for
bugs where we accidentally generate code that depends on CPU
state which isn't reflected in the TB flags. Stop doing this
and instead use DisasContext as a way to pass around those
bits of CPU state which are known to be safe to use.

This commit simply removes initial "CPUARMState *env" parameters
from various function definitions, and removes the initial "env"
argument from the places where those functions are called.

The M profile cpu_exec_interrupt handling is fairly simple
but does include an M profile specific oddity (disabling
interrupts for certain PC values). A/R profile handling
on the other hand is getting rapidly more complicated
with the support for EL2 and EL3. Split the M profile
code out into its own implementation of cpu_exec_interrupt
to keep these two things out of each others' way.

+    /* ARMv7-M interrupt return works by loading a magic value
+     * into the PC.  On real hardware the load causes the
+     * return to occur.  The qemu implementation performs the
+     * jump normally, then does the exception return when the
+     * CPU tries to execute code at the magic address.
+     * This will cause the magic PC value to be pushed to
+     * the stack if an interrupt occurred at the wrong time.
+     * We avoid this by disabling interrupts when
+     * pc contains a magic address.
+     */
